Butternut Squash Soup

by sara
No comments yet

Ingredients

1 large butternut squash (4-5 lbs.), peeled and cut into large chunks
1 large apple, peeled, cored and quartered
1 large onion, chopped
curry powder
salt
vegetable oil
butter (optional)

Preparation

Sauté the onion in oil (and butter, if using butter) with curry powder and salt. Once onion is cooked (translucent), add the apple and continue to sauté for a few moments.

Linda’s Mini Cheesecakes

by sara
No comments yet

Ingredients

2/3 cup Graham cracker crumbs
2 tbs. butter, melted
8oz. cream cheese (1 small package)
1 tsp. vanilla extract
1 egg
1/3 cup sugar
a miniature muffin tin and mini muffin tin liners

Preparation

Crust: combine crumbs and butter, and press into miniature muffin tins.
Filling: Beat cream cheese, vanilla, egg and sugar. Pour batter into muffin tins.
